June 8th, 2022
 
Mamma Mia! Performances Postponed

As a consequence of an outbreak of COVID-19 in the cast and crew of Mamma Mia! the BTG has been obliged to postpone a number of the scheduled performances of Mamma Mia!

This postponement allows us to accomplish two things: 

1) grant time to the cast and crew who are symptomatic (none severe to date!) to recover and

2) apply the applicable COVID-19 protocols to suppress the continuation of the outbreak.  This will include a deep clean of the theatre.

To this end the performances scheduled for  June 5, 8, 9, 10, 11, 12 have been postponed. New dates will be announced once we receive word of continuation. 

For all of those who will be returning to the theatre note that the BTG Board has now established a policy that masks shall be worn by everyone present in the Pinnacle Playhouse included audience, house staff, cast and crew.  The only exception to this rule is that masks are not required by actors that are on-stage as part of the performance.
